SPONSORED POST*
Cryptocurrency exchanges have become prime targets for cybercriminals due to the high value of digital assets they handle. As the crypto industry continues to grow, so does the sophistication of hacking attempts. This article explores best practices for crypto exchanges to enhance their security protocols and protect against potential breaches.
Summary
The Threat Landscape
The first step in securing a crypto exchange is understanding the various threats it faces. Hackers employ a wide range of tactics, from social engineering and phishing attacks to more technical exploits like SQL injection and DDoS attacks. It’s crucial for exchanges to stay informed about emerging threats and continuously update their security measures.
This principle of constant vigilance applies across various digital platforms, including online gaming. Just as users should only trust reputable platforms like this website for secure online gaming experiences, crypto traders must choose exchanges with robust security measures in place.
Implementation of Multi-Factor Authentication (MFA)
One of the most effective ways to enhance security is by implementing multi-factor authentication. This adds an extra layer of protection beyond just a username and password, typically involving:
- Something the user knows (password)
- Something the user has (smartphone or security key)
- Something the user is (biometric data).
Utilization of Cold Storage for Funds
What is Cold Storage?
Cold storage refers to keeping the majority of crypto assets offline, away from internet-connected systems. This dramatically reduces the attack surface available to hackers.
Best Practices for Cold Storage:
- Use hardware wallets for storing private keys
- Implement multi-signature wallets requiring multiple approvals for transactions
- Regularly audit and rotate cold storage addresses.
Enhancement of Network Security
Implementing robust firewalls and intrusion detection systems (IDS) helps prevent unauthorized access and detect potential threats in real time. Additionally, conducting regular security audits, including penetration testing, helps identify vulnerabilities before they can be exploited by malicious actors.
Encryption and Secure Communication
All sensitive data, both at rest and in transit, should be encrypted using strong, up-to-date encryption protocols. This includes:
- User data and credentials
- Transaction information
- API communications.
Employee Training and Access Control
Regular security awareness training for all employees helps create a culture of security and reduces the risk of human error. Furthermore, implementing the principle of least privilege ensures that employees only have access to the systems and data necessary for their roles, minimizing the potential impact of a compromised account.
Secure Development Practices
Implementing rigorous code review processes and comprehensive testing, including security-focused testing, helps identify and address vulnerabilities early in the development cycle. Also, adhering to secure coding standards and best practices helps prevent common vulnerabilities like SQL injection and cross-site scripting (XSS) attacks.
Incident Response Plan
Having a well-documented and regularly updated incident response plan is crucial for minimizing damage in the event of a security breach. Conducting regular drills and updating the incident response plan based on new threats and lessons learned ensures the team is prepared to act swiftly and effectively in case of an attack.
Monitoring and Logging
Implementing real-time monitoring of all systems and transactions helps detect unusual activity that could indicate a breach in progress. Furthermore, maintaining detailed logs of all system activities and transactions is crucial for forensic analysis in the event of a security incident.
Third-Party Risk Management
Thoroughly vetting all third-party vendors and partners to ensure they meet the exchange’s security standards is essential. Also, conducting regular audits of third-party integrations and services helps identify potential vulnerabilities introduced by external partners.
Regulatory Compliance
Keeping up-to-date with relevant regulatory requirements and industry standards helps ensure the exchange’s security measures meet or exceed legal obligations. Moreover, conducting regular compliance audits helps identify any gaps in security measures and ensures ongoing adherence to regulatory requirements.
User Education and Support
Providing clear security guidelines and best practices to users helps them protect their accounts and assets. Furthermore, offering responsive customer support and promptly addressing security concerns helps build trust and can prevent potential security issues from escalating.
Bottom Line
Securing a crypto exchange against hacks is an ongoing process that requires a multi-faceted approach. By implementing these best practices, exchanges can significantly enhance their security posture and protect both their assets and their users’ funds.
However, it’s important to remember that security is not a one-time effort but a continuous process of improvement and adaptation. As the threat landscape evolves, so too must the security measures employed by crypto exchanges. Regular assessments, updates, and a commitment to staying ahead of potential threats are key to maintaining a secure trading environment.
By prioritizing security and implementing robust measures, crypto exchanges can build trust with their users and contribute to the overall stability and growth of the cryptocurrency ecosystem. As the industry continues to mature, those exchanges that demonstrate a strong commitment to security will be best positioned to thrive in this dynamic and challenging landscape.
*This article was paid for. Cryptonomist did not write the article or test the platform.